Parco Rile Tenore Olona (RTO), located between the provinces of Varese and Como, is famous for its dense network of woodland paths, local roads, and historic winding connections that run along the streams and climb the terraces of the Olona Valley.

Among the most iconic road sections and routes that fit this description, the famous "Piccolo Stelvio" in Gornate Olona stands out, an asphalt road within the park known to all cyclists for its tight hairpin bends that are a miniature reminder of the famous Alpine pass.

The Little Stelvio Climb

Highlight (Segment) • Climb

The Piccolo Stelvio is a short climb that visually recalls the much more prestigious and majestic hairpin bends of the well-known Coppi peak par excellence. It starts from Castiglione Olona (VA), along the SP42. At the first houses of the characteristic village, on the right you can see the sign describing the climb. It is a total of 5 hairpin bends, which rise rapidly and decisively above the town. Walking along it, you will have for a brief moment the feeling of being on the asphalt of the "big brother".
